Step-by-Step Process

Here’s where things get exciting. Grab a big pot; it’s time to cook!

  1. Combine the chicken broth and water in the pot. Bring to a gentle boil (aim for those bubbles, folks).
  2. Toss in the shredded chicken and a teaspoon of minced ginger . Stir it around.
  3. If you’re feeling veggie vibes, now's the time to add in that cup of mixed veggies . Let them simmer for 5 minutes .
  4. Now, we’ve got a little magic with the cornstarch. Whisk together 1 tablespoon of cornstarch with 2 tablespoons of cold water. Slowly pour this into your soup while mixing to thicken things up.
  5. Lower that heat to low. Pour in 2 beaten eggs , stirring slowly to create beautiful egg ribbons. This is what makes the soup special!
  6. Toss in the sliced green onions, season with salt and pepper, then turn off the heat. Voila!

Preparation time:

10 Mins
Cooking time:

15 Mins
Yield:
🍽️
4 servings

⚖️ Ingredients:

  • 2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 cup cooked chicken, shredded
  • 2 large eggs, beaten
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ch, mixed with 2 tablespoons cold water
  • 1 teaspoon fresh ginger, minced
  • 2 green onions, sliced
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 cup mixed vegetables (optional)

🥄 Instructions:

  1. Step 1: In a large pot, combine the chicken broth and water, and bring to a gentle boil.
  2. Step 2: Add the shredded chicken and minced ginger, stirring to combine.
  3. Step 3: If using mixed vegetables, add them to the pot and simmer for 5 minutes until tender.
  4. Step 4: Whisk together the cornstarch mixture and slowly pour it into the soup while stirring to thicken the broth.
  5. Step 5: Reduce the heat to low and slowly pour in the beaten eggs while gently stirring the soup to create ribbons.
  6. Step 6: Add the sliced green onions, and season with salt and pepper to taste.
  7. Step 7: Remove from heat and serve hot, garnished with additional green onions.
